Understanding MetaMask and BNB Chain


MetaMask is a popular Ethereum-based digital wallet that allows users to securely store cryptocurrencies like Ether (ETH) and tokens on the Ethereum network. It also functions as an interface for interacting with smart contracts, enabling users to execute transactions without directly managing private keys or dealing with complex cryptographic protocols. The versatility of MetaMask lies in its ability to connect to various blockchain networks by adding different chains' configurations. This flexibility is crucial when accessing DeFi applications that are specific to non-Ethereum blockchains, such as Binance Smart Chain (BSC) and its native token, BNB.

How to Add BNB Chain to MetaMask


To add the BNB Chain to your MetaMask wallet, you can follow this step-by-step guide:


1. Open MetaMask: Start by clicking on the MetaMask icon in your web browser's toolbar or taskbar, depending on your platform and browser settings. This action will open the MetaMask interface if it was previously closed.


2. Select Network: On the upper-left corner of the MetaMask window, you will find a network selection button. Clicking this button reveals a list of available networks that MetaMask can connect to.


3. Add BNB Chain: Instead of selecting an existing network, look for an option or action labeled "Add Network" (as mentioned in revoke.cash guides). This action initiates the manual setup process required to add non-Ethereum chains like BNB Chain.


4. Configure Connection Details: Once you've selected "Add Network," a configuration window will appear. You need to input specific details about the network:


Chain ID: The chain ID for BNB Chain is 56. This unique identifier ensures that your wallet connects correctly with the intended blockchain.


RPC URL: The RPC (Remote Procedure Call) endpoint for connecting MetaMask to the BNB Chain network. You can find this information on sites like ChainList or through official Binance Smart Chain documentation.


Chain Name: Input "BSC Testnet" or simply "BNB Testnet" as per the context and network you're intending to connect to.


Symbol: For BNB, the symbol is 'BNB'; for other tokens on this chain, adjust accordingly.


Native Currency: The native currency of BNB Chain is BNB. Enter "BNB" as both the name and symbol.


Explorer URL: The block explorer URL allows you to view transaction history. For BSC testnet, the URL could be 'https://testnet.bscscan.com'.


5. Confirm Network: After filling in all required fields correctly, MetaMask will prompt a confirmation request. Select "Add" to finalize your settings for the BNB Chain network.


6. Switch to Network: To use this newly added network with your MetaMask wallet, simply select it from the network selection menu. You are now ready to interact with DeFi applications and smart contracts on the Binance Smart Chain.
